Vil du lære hvordan du konfigurerer Grafana Radius-godkjenning på Apache? I denne opplæringen skal vi vise deg hvordan du autentisere Grafana-brukere ved hjelp av Apache Radius-modulen for HTTP-godkjenning.

• Ubuntu 18
• Ubuntu 19
• Grafana 6.4.4
• Freeradius 3.0.17

Grafana Tutorial:

På denne siden tilbyr vi rask tilgang til en liste over Grafana tutorials.

Tutorial Grafana – FreeRadius Server Installasjon

• IP – 192.168.15.10.
• Driftssystem – Ubuntu 19.10
• Vertsnavn – UBUNTU

Bruk følgende kommandoer på Linux-konsollen til å installere FreeRadius-tjenesten.

Copy to Clipboard

Nå må vi legge freeradius klienter til clients.conf;.

Finn og rediger clients.conf.

Copy to Clipboard

Legg til følgende linjer på slutten av filen clients.conf.

Copy to Clipboard

I vårt eksempel legger vi til 1 klientenhet:

Klientenheten ble kalt GRAFANA og har IP-adressen 192.168.15.11.

Nå må vi legge til FreeRadius-brukere i BRUKER-konfigurasjonsfilen.

Finn og rediger konfigurasjonsfilen for Freeradius-brukere.

Copy to Clipboard

Legge til følgende linjer på slutten av filen

Copy to Clipboard

Vi opprettet en Radius-konto med navnet admin.

Start Freeradius-serveren på nytt.

Copy to Clipboard

Test konfigurasjonsfilen for radiusserveren.

Copy to Clipboard

Du er ferdig med Freeradius-installasjonen på Ubuntu Linux.

Tutorial – Grafana Installasjon

• IP – 192.168.15.11
• Driftssystem – Ubuntu 19.10
• Vertsnavn – GRAFANA

Bruk følgende kommandoer på Linux-konsollen til å installere MySQL-databasetjenesten.

Copy to Clipboard

Få tilgang til Kommandolinjen MySQL.

Copy to Clipboard

Opprett en database med navnet grafana.

Copy to Clipboard

Opprett en databasebrukerkonto med navnet grafana.

Copy to Clipboard

Gi SQL-brukeren navnet grafana tillatelse over databasen kalt grafana.

Copy to Clipboard

Bruk følgende kommandoer på Linux-konsollen til å konfigurere Grafana APT-repositoriet.

Copy to Clipboard

Bruk følgende kommando for å installere Grafana.

Copy to Clipboard

Rediger grafana-konfigurasjonsfilen grafana.ini.

Copy to Clipboard

Utfør følgende konfigurasjon under delene [Database] [Session] og .

Copy to Clipboard

Husk at du må endre MySQL brukernavn og passord for å gjenspeile miljøet ditt.

Bruk følgende kommando til å starte Grafana-tjenesten.

Copy to Clipboard

Grafana-tjenesten vil begynne å lytte på TCP-port 3000.

Hvis du vil teste Grafana-installasjonen, åpner du nettleseren og skriver inn IP-adressen til serveren pluss:3000.

I vårt eksempel ble følgende URL skrevet inn i nettleseren:

• http://192.168.15.11:3000

Grafana-webgrensesnittet skal presenteres.

Skriv inn påloggingsinformasjonen for Grafana Default Password på ledetekstskjermen.

• Brukernavn: admin
• Passord: admin

Systemet vil be deg om å endre Grafana standardpassordet.

Gratulerer! Du er ferdig med Grafana grunnleggende installasjon.

Tutorial Grafana – Apache Proxy Installasjon

• IP – 192.168.15.11
• Driftssystem – Ubuntu 19.10
• Vertsnavn – GRAFANA

Nå må vi installere Apache-webserveren og konfigurere den til å fungere som proxy for Grafana-tjenesten.

Installer Apache-webserveren og de nødvendige pakkene.

Copy to Clipboard

Aktiver de nødvendige Apache-modulene.

Copy to Clipboard

Nå må vi konfigurere Apache port 80 som proxy til Grafana service port 3000.

Vi må også konfigurere Apache for å be om Radius-autentisering til brukere som prøver å acess Grafana.

Rediger konfigurasjonsfilen for Apache 000-default.conf.

Copy to Clipboard

Her er 000-default.conf-filen før konfigurasjonen vår.

Copy to Clipboard

Her er 000-default.conf-filen etter konfigurasjonen vår.

Copy to Clipboard

Start Apache-tjenesten på nytt.

Copy to Clipboard

Rediger grafana-konfigurasjonsfilen grafana.ini.

Copy to Clipboard

Utfør følgende konfigurasjon under [auth .proxy] området.

Copy to Clipboard

Start Grafana-tjenesten på nytt.

Copy to Clipboard

Apache-tjenesten vil lytte på TCP-port 80, godkjenne brukeren på Radius-databasen og omdirigere brukere til Grafana-tjenesten på port 3000.

For å teste Apache proxy-installasjonen din, åpne nettleseren din og skriv inn IP-adressen til serveren din.

I vårt eksempel ble følgende URL skrevet inn i nettleseren:

• http://192.168.15.11

Apache-proxyen vil be deg om å autentisere deg selv før du videresender deg til Grafana-tjenesten.

På påloggingsskjermen bruker du administratorbrukeren og passordet fra Apache htpasswd-filen.

• Brukernavn: admin
• Passord: Skriv inn admin Radius-passordet. [boss123]

Etter en vellykket pålogging vil du bli sendt direkte til Grafana dashbordet.

Gratulerer! Du har konfigurert Apache Proxy-godkjenning for å få tilgang til Grafana-serice.